Strategic Insights: Coaching Decisions and Game Plans
Let’s jump into the strategic side of the game and look at how the coaches influence the outcome through their decisions and game plans. The managers' decisions on player selections and lineup construction have a big impact. They will choose the players who they think will give them the best chance to win, considering both offensive and defensive strengths. Managers will also analyze the opponent’s strategy and make adjustments to counter their moves. These decisions can affect everything from the game's beginning to its dramatic finish. The managers also have to make pitching changes. Deciding when to pull a starting pitcher and bring in relief pitchers is one of the most important aspects. These decisions can impact the game's flow and affect a team’s chance of success. Effective bullpen management is very crucial. Coaches have to utilize their relievers strategically, ensuring they are ready to face specific batters or situations. The strategic use of the bullpen can protect leads and limit the opposition's runs. Coaches also use in-game adjustments. During the game, coaches will make strategic decisions. These adjustments may be based on the game's flow, the opponent’s moves, and the players' performance. These adjustments include changes in the batting order, defensive shifts, and aggressive base running. All of this can dramatically affect the outcome. Strategic plays, such as hit-and-runs, stolen bases, and defensive shifts, are also very important. Managers decide when to use these plays to exploit weaknesses, advance runners, or limit the opponent's scoring opportunities. These strategic elements often make the difference.
